리눅스는 오픈 소스 운영 체제로, 다양한 배포판이 존재합니다. 그중에서도 우분투는 사용자 친화적인 인터페이스와 강력한 커뮤니티 지원으로 많은 사랑을 받고 있습니다. 하지만 리눅스와 우분투는 같은 기반에서 시작했지만, 그 특성과 용도에서는 큰 차이를 보입니다. 리눅스는 커널을 의미하며, 여러 배포판의 토대가 되는 반면, 우분투는 그 중 하나의 배포판으로서 특정 목적과 사용자 경험을 제공합니다. 아래 글에서 자세하게 알아봅시다.
리눅스와 우분투의 기초 이해하기
리눅스의 정의와 역할
리눅스는 오픈 소스 운영 체제의 커널로, 1991년 리누스 토발즈에 의해 처음 개발되었습니다. 이 커널은 컴퓨터 하드웨어와 소프트웨어 간의 상호작용을 관리하며, 다양한 응용 프로그램이 원활하게 실행될 수 있도록 지원합니다. 리눅스는 그 자체로도 사용할 수 있지만, 일반적으로 여러 배포판의 기반으로 활용됩니다. 이러한 배포판들은 각기 다른 목적과 사용자 경험을 제공하여 특정 용도에 최적화된 환경을 만들어냅니다.
우분투의 역사와 발전
우분투는 2004년에 시작된 리눅스 배포판 중 하나로, 데비안(Debian) 기반으로 구축되었습니다. “우분투”라는 이름은 남아프리카 언어에서 유래한 것으로, ‘인간성’ 또는 ‘상호 의존성’을 의미합니다. 이는 우분투 개발자들이 공동체 중심의 철학을 중요시한다는 것을 반영합니다. 초기부터 사용자 친화적인 인터페이스와 쉬운 설치 과정을 통해 많은 사용자를 확보했으며, 지금까지도 지속적으로 업데이트되고 있습니다.
리눅스 커널과 우분투의 관계
우분투는 리눅스 커널 위에서 동작하는 운영 체제입니다. 즉, 우분투는 리눅스를 기반으로 한 배포판이기 때문에 기본적인 시스템 자원 관리 및 하드웨어 접근은 리눅스 커널이 담당합니다. 따라서 우분투를 사용하는 사용자는 리눅스 커널의 모든 장점을 누릴 수 있으며, 동시에 더 나은 사용자 경험과 다양한 소프트웨어 패키지에 접근할 수 있게 됩니다.

리눅스 LINUX 배포판 우분투 UBUNTU 무슨 차이?
사용자 경험 및 인터페이스 비교
우분투의 사용자 인터페이스
우분투는 GNOME 데스크탑 환경을 기본으로 제공하며, 직관적이고 깔끔한 디자인 덕분에 많은 사용자들이 쉽게 적응할 수 있습니다. 메뉴 바와 대시(dash)를 통해 애플리케이션과 파일에 빠르게 접근할 수 있고, 개인 설정도 손쉽게 조정할 수 있습니다. 이러한 편리함 덕분에 초보자부터 숙련된 사용자까지 모두가 만족할 만한 환경이 조성되어 있습니다.
다양한 리눅스 배포판들의 특징
리눅스에는 우분투 외에도 다양한 배포판이 존재하며 각각 독특한 특성과 기능을 갖추고 있습니다. 예를 들어, 센트OS(CentOS)는 서버 환경에서 안정성과 보안을 중시하고, 페도라(Fedora)는 최신 기술을 적극 반영하여 실험적인 요소가 많이 포함되어 있습니다. 이런 다양성 덕분에 사용자는 자신의 필요와 기술 수준에 맞는 배포판을 선택할 수 있는 폭넓은 선택지를 가집니다.
커뮤니티 지원 및 업데이트
우분투는 강력한 커뮤니티 지원으로 유명합니다. 공식 포럼이나 IRC 채널에서는 사용자가 질문하고 답변 받을 수 있는 활발한 공간이 마련되어 있으며, 많은 문서와 튜토리얼이 제공됩니다. 또한 정기적인 업데이트를 통해 보안 문제를 해결하고 새로운 기능들을 추가하여 항상 최신 상태로 유지되고 있습니다. 이는 다른 많은 리눅스 배포판에서도 찾아볼 수 있지만, 우분투만큼 활발하게 운영되는 경우는 드물다고 할 수 있습니다.
소프트웨어 관리 방식 비교하기
패키지 관리 시스템 이해하기
리눅스에서는 소프트웨어 설치 및 관리를 위해 패키지 관리 시스템이 사용됩니다. 각 배포판마다 고유한 패키지 형식을 가지고 있는데, 우분투에서는 DEB 형식과 APT(Advanced Package Tool)를 활용합니다. 이를 통해 사용자는 명령줄이나 그래픽 인터페이스를 통해 손쉽게 소프트웨어를 검색하고 설치하거나 제거할 수 있습니다.
소프트웨어 저장소와 접근성
우분투는 광범위한 소프트웨어 저장소를 제공하여 사용자가 필요한 소프트웨어를 쉽게 찾고 설치할 수 있도록 돕습니다. 공식 저장소 외에도 PPA(Personal Package Archive)를 이용해 개인 혹은 비공식적으로 개발된 패키지도 추가로 설치할 수 있는 여지가 많습니다. 이는 특히 특정 응용 프로그램이나 최신 버전을 필요로 하는 경우 매우 유용하게 작용합니다.
커스터마이징 가능성 비교
리눅스를 기반으로 한 모든 배포판은 높은 수준의 커스터마이징 가능성을 제공합니다만, 각각의 접근 방식에는 차이가 있을 수 있습니다. 우분투 역시 다양한 테마 및 플러그인을 지원하여 개인 사용자의 취향에 맞춰 시스템 모양새를 바꿀 수 있게 합니다. 그러나 일부 다른 배포판들은 더욱 깊숙한 설정 변경이나 UI 수정 등을 허용하여 기술적으로 숙련된 사용자들에게 더 큰 자유도를 제공합니다.
보안 및 안정성 측면에서 보기
리눅스 보안 모델 이해하기
리눅스는 그 구조상 다중 사용자 환경을 지원하며 권한 관리 시스템을 통해 보안성을 높이고 있습니다. 기본적으로 모든 파일과 프로세서는 특정 사용자에게 속하며 이들 간의 접근 권한이 엄격히 구별됩니다. 이러한 점에서 공격자가 시스템 내부에 침입하더라도 전체 시스템에 대한 통제를 얻기는 어렵습니다.
우분투의 보안 업데이트 정책
우분투는 정기적으로 보안 업데이트를 출시하여 알려진 취약점을 신속하게 해결하는 정책을 유지하고 있습니다. LTS(Long Term Support) 버전은 5년 동안 보안 업데이트가 제공되므로 기업 환경에서도 안정성을 요구하는 사용자들에게 큰 인기를 끌고 있습니다. 이런 주기적인 관리 덕택에 많은 기업들이 안전하게 우분투를 도입하고 있는 것입니다.
다른 배포판들과 비교했을 때 안정성 차이점
각 리눅스 배포판마다 안정성을 위한 철학이나 정책이 다르게 적용될 수 있으며, 이에 따라 실제 성능에서도 차이를 보입니다. 예를 들어 센트OS나 레드햇(Red Hat)은 기업 환경에서 높은 안정성을 목표로 하고 있어 장기간 테스트된 패키지만 포함하는 경향이 강하지만, 우붐부는 좀 더 최신 기술이나 업데이트가 포함되어 있어 상대적으로 변화가 빠르기도 합니다.
결론 없이 마무리 짓기 위한 고려 사항들
목적과 용도에 따른 선택 기준 제시하기
사용자는 자신의 필요와 목적에 맞춰 적합한 운영 체제를 선택해야 합니다. 예를 들어 서버 구축이나 전문적인 개발 환경에서는 안정성과 보안성이 중요한 만큼 센트OS나 레드햇 계열을 고려해야 할 것입니다 반면 일상적인 개인 컴퓨터 작업이나 미디어 소비 등에는 우븐부처럼 사용자 친화적인 인터페이스가 도움이 될 것입니다.
사용자 경험 향상을 위한 추가 자료 소개하기
사용자가 새로운 배포판으로 전환하거나 Linux 세계에 처음 발을 들여놓으려 할 때 유용한 자원들이 많이 존재합니다 온라인 포럼이나 교육 플랫폼에서는 기본적인 명령어부터 고급 기술까지 다양한 튜토리얼과 학습 자료가 풍부하니 이를 참고하면 좋습니다 또한 YouTube 같은 플랫폼에서도 시청각 자료를 통해 쉽고 재미있게 배우실 수도 있을 것입니다.
미래 지향적 관점에서 바라보기
Linux 생태계는 계속해서 성장하고 발전해 나갈 것이며 이에 따라 새로운 기술과 혁신적인 아이디어들이 등장할 것입니다 따라서 현재 어떤 배포판이든지 그 특성과 장점을 잘 이해하고 적절히 활용한다면 앞으로 다가올 변화를 대비하는데 큰 도움이 될 것입니다
최종적으로 마무리
리눅스와 우분투는 다양한 용도와 사용자 요구에 맞춰 설계된 강력한 운영 체제입니다. 각 배포판은 고유한 특성과 장점을 가지고 있으며, 사용자 경험을 극대화하기 위한 다양한 도구와 커뮤니티 지원이 마련되어 있습니다. 사용자는 자신의 필요에 따라 적합한 배포판을 선택하고, 이를 통해 효율적인 작업 환경을 구축할 수 있습니다. 앞으로도 리눅스 생태계는 지속적으로 발전할 것이므로, 이를 잘 활용하는 것이 중요합니다.
유익한 참고 사항
1. 리눅스 관련 온라인 포럼과 커뮤니티에서 질문하고 답변을 받을 수 있습니다.
2. 다양한 교육 플랫폼에서 리눅스 기초부터 고급 기술까지 학습할 수 있는 자료가 제공됩니다.
3. YouTube와 같은 비디오 플랫폼에서 시청각 자료를 통해 쉽게 배우고 이해할 수 있습니다.
4. 각 배포판의 공식 웹사이트에서 최신 정보와 업데이트를 확인할 수 있습니다.
5. 우분투 및 기타 리눅스 배포판의 설치 가이드를 참조하여 손쉽게 시스템을 설정할 수 있습니다.
핵심 요약
리눅스는 오픈 소스 운영 체제로서 다양한 배포판을 통해 사용자에게 맞춤형 경험을 제공합니다. 우분투는 그 중 하나로, 사용자 친화적인 인터페이스와 강력한 커뮤니티 지원으로 많은 인기를 끌고 있습니다. 패키지 관리 시스템과 보안 업데이트 정책은 사용자가 안정적이고 효율적으로 소프트웨어를 관리할 수 있도록 돕습니다. 최종적으로, 사용자는 자신의 목적에 맞는 배포판을 선택하여 리눅스를 효과적으로 활용해야 합니다.
자주 묻는 질문 (FAQ) 📖
Q: 리눅스와 우분투의 차이는 무엇인가요?
A: 리눅스는 운영 체제의 커널을 가리키며, 다양한 배포판이 존재합니다. 우분투는 이러한 리눅스 커널을 기반으로 한 특정한 배포판으로, 사용자 친화적인 인터페이스와 설치 및 사용의 용이성으로 유명합니다.
Q: 우분투는 어떤 용도로 주로 사용되나요?
A: 우분투는 서버 및 데스크톱 환경에서 모두 사용되며, 웹 서버, 데이터베이스 서버, 개발 환경 등 다양한 용도로 활용됩니다. 또한, 일반 사용자도 손쉽게 사용할 수 있도록 설계되어 있어 개인 컴퓨터에서도 많이 사용됩니다.
Q: 리눅스 배포판은 왜 여러 가지가 있나요?
A: 리눅스 배포판은 사용자 요구에 따라 다양한 기능과 디자인을 제공하기 위해 여러 개발자와 커뮤니티에 의해 만들어집니다. 각 배포판은 특정 목적이나 사용자 그룹을 겨냥하여 최적화되어 있으며, 사용자의 취향이나 필요에 따라 선택할 수 있습니다.
